Tankless Water Heater Repair in Fort Lauderdale, FL
Tankless water heater repair services focus on diagnosing and fixing issues with on-demand water heating systems commonly used in homes throughout Fort Lauderdale and nearby areas. These services cover a range of projects, including addressing problems like inconsistent water temperature, unusual noises, leaks, or failure to produce hot water. Property owners often seek repairs for units that are not functioning efficiently, have developed corrosion or mineral buildup, or experience frequent outages, ensuring their hot water supply remains reliable and energy-efficient.
Before requesting tankless water heater repair, property owners typically want to understand the common causes of system malfunctions and the signs indicating repairs are needed. It’s helpful to be aware of potential issues such as sediment buildup, thermostat failures, or gas supply problems. Clarifying the age of the unit and recent usage patterns can assist in diagnosing the problem accurately.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of the system and improve overall performance.

Common Tankless Water Heater Repair Jobs
Tankless Water Heater Repair - addresses issues like inconsistent hot water and system leaks.
Heating Element Replacement - restores proper heating function to ensure hot water supply.
Flow Sensor and Thermostat Repair - fixes faulty sensors to maintain accurate temperature control.
Control Board Troubleshooting - resolves electronic component failures affecting operation.
Vent and Exhaust System Repairs - ensures proper venting to prevent safety hazards and improve efficiency.
System Diagnostics and Inspection - identifies underlying problems to prevent future breakdowns.
Tankless Water Heater Repair Questions
What are common signs that a tankless water heater needs repair? Signs include inconsistent water temperature, unusual noises, or reduced hot water flow. If these occur, a professional inspection is recommended.
Can a tankless water heater be repaired on-site? Yes, many issues can be diagnosed and fixed without removing the unit, depending on the problem's nature and severity.
What issues typically cause a tankless water heater to stop working? Common causes include mineral buildup, faulty sensors, or electrical problems that disrupt proper operation.
Is it better to repair or replace a tankless water heater? Repair is suitable for minor issues, but if the unit is outdated or has frequent problems, replacement may be more practical. A professional can advise on the best option.
